1 竞价与广告位置之间的关系:假设竞价越高广告位置越靠前。可以使用一个函数来描述这种关系例如线性函数:广告位置 = a 竞价 + b其中 a 和 b 是待定系数。2 广告位置与曝光次数之间的关系:假设广告位置越靠前曝光次数越多。可以使用一个函数来描述这种关系例如指数函数:曝光次数 = c expd 广告位置其中 c 和 d 是待定系数。3 竞价与曝光次数之间的关系:将上述两个关系联立起来即曝
以下是一个使用Matlab的示例程序,从文件中读取曝光次数和竞价数据,并根据上述模型进行拟合和预测。
% 读取数据
data = xlsread('B题-某产品线上广告投放历史数据.xlsx');
impression = data(:, 1); % 曝光次数数据
CPC = data(:, 2); % 竞价数据
% 定义模型函数
model = @(x, p) p(1) * exp(p(2) * (p(3) * x + p(4))) * p(5);
% 定义拟合函数
fitFunc = @(p) model(CPC, p) - impression;
% 初始猜测参数值
p0 = [1, 1, 1, 1, 1];
% 使用最小二乘法拟合参数
p = lsqnonlin(fitFunc, p0);
% 输出参数值
a = p(3);
b = p(4);
c = p(1);
d = p(2);
% 预测曝光次数
CPC_pred = 1.5; % 假设竞价为1.5
impression_pred = model(CPC_pred, p);
disp(['预测竞价为1.5时的曝光次数为:', num2str(impression_pred)]);
请确保在运行此程序之前将文件名为B题-某产品线上广告投放历史数据.xlsx的文件放置在正确的目录下,并且已经安装并加载了Matlab的xlsx读取函数。
这个程序假设了一个包含曝光次数和竞价数据的Excel文件,其中曝光次数在第一列,竞价在第二列。根据这些数据,使用最小二乘法拟合出模型中的参数值,并根据模型预测了竞价为1.5时的曝光次数
原文地址: http://www.cveoy.top/t/topic/h5nE 著作权归作者所有。请勿转载和采集!